Helen B. Motes
Helen B. Motes, 82, of Goshen died in her home.
Services will be
held at 2 p.m. Friday, May 9, 2003, at 2 p.m. at Goshen Baptist Church in Goshen with the Revs. W.O. Sanders and David Zorn officiating. The body will lie in state from 1-2 p.m. the day of the service.
Burial will follow in Elam Primitive Baptist Church Cemetery in Goshen with Skeen Funeral Home directing.
Visitation will be from 6-8 p.m. Thursday, May 8, 2003, at Skeen Funeral Home in Troy.
She was born July 28, 1921, in Franconia, N.H., to the late Fred Brooks and the late Bertha Whitney. She was a high school graduate and homemaker. She was a member of Goshen Baptist Church and was saved on Mother's Day 1965. She also served in the U.S. Army WAAC in 1943. She was a member of the American Legion Post #207 in Goshen and was married to John P. Motes on Sept. 26, 1943.
She was preceded in death by a son, Kerry L. Motes.
Survivors include her husband, John P. Motes of Goshen; a son, David John Motes of Mobile; a daughter, Judith Holmes of Tuscaloosa; a sister, Pauline B. Goudie of Lisbon, N.H.; and numerous gr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
Pallbearers will be the men of Goshen Baptist Church. The family requests memorials be made to Goshen Baptist Church.
